NAB Asset Servicing Expands In New Zealand Through Deal

NAB Asset Servicing, the settlement and custody arm of National Australia Bank, has partnered with MMc Limited, the New Zealand-based investment administration firm, in a deal that expands the former's fund administration network into New Zealand. The alliance allows NAB Asset Servicing to offer fund administration services in the New Zealand market to complement its existing custody service offering in the country. To date, NAB provides services to some 300 domestic and international institutions covering various types of securities. MMc has been operating in New Zealand since 2004 and as of 30 June 2011 provided outsourced investment services to 25 clients, including around 140 investment funds, for funds under management of NZ$4.4 billion ($3.3 billion). The initiative come following the appointment of Peter Hele as product and strategic alliances managing director in August. Hele was previously the managing director for NAB's client relationships division.
